Top 10 Best Addison County Public Elementary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 18 public elementary schools serving 2,839 students in Addison County, VT.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Addison County, VT are Monkton Central School, Bingham Memorial School and Ferrisburgh Central School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Addison County, VT public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 42% (versus the Vermont public elementary school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 53% (versus the 48% statewide average). Elementary schools in Addison County have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Vermont public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Vermont public elementary school average of 11% (majority Hispanic and Black).
